Nigeria vs. Uganda Live: Super Eagles Aim for Victory Before AFCON Knockout Stage

Nigeria's Super Eagles are set to face Uganda in their final Group C match of the 2025 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) in Morocco, with kickoff scheduled for 5 pm local time (16:00 GMT) at the Fez Stadium in Fes. While Nigeria has already secured its place in the round of 16, the stakes are high for Uganda, who need a win to keep their hopes of advancing in the tournament alive.

Nigeria enters the match as the favorite, having won their first two group matches against Tanzania (2-1) and Tunisia (3-2). The Super Eagles have displayed strong attacking form, scoring in each of their last nine AFCON matches and aiming to win all three group games for the first time since 2021. However, head coach Eric Chelle may opt to rotate the squad, giving opportunities to players like goalkeeper Stanley Nwabali, defenders Bright Osayi-Samuel and Sanusi, midfielders Dele Bashiru and Onyeka, and forwards Paul Onuachu and Moses Simon. Players such as Victor Osimhen and Ademola Lookman may be rested to avoid the risk of suspension.

Uganda, on the other hand, sits third in Group C with only one point after a 3-1 defeat to Tunisia and a 1-1 draw with Tanzania. The Cranes need a victory to boost their chances of qualifying for the round of 16. Uganda's coach, Paul Put, acknowledges the strength of the Nigerian team but emphasizes the importance of securing a good result. Key players for Uganda include defenders like Jordan Obita and forwards like Uche Ikpeazu, who scored in the draw against Tanzania.

Historically, Uganda holds a slight edge over Nigeria, with four wins to Nigeria's two in their eight encounters. Uganda is also unbeaten in their last three matches against Nigeria. Their only previous AFCON meeting was in the semi-finals of the 1978 tournament, where Uganda won 2-1.

The match will be broadcast on SuperSport channels 252 and 254 in Nigeria, SABC 2 in South Africa, and Canal+ Afrique in French-speaking countries.

As Nigeria looks to maintain its momentum and Uganda fights for survival, the stage is set for a compelling encounter at the AFCON 2025.
